I think this was my third time re-watching. Probably my favorite low-budget film of all time. Rather than give actors a script, the director gave them cue cards with 'goals for the day' and just let them act out the scene in whatever way came naturally. One of the actors was also the writer of the script and so was able to sometimes steer scenes in the direction they wanted things to go in. Not bad for a movie shot in 5 days on a $50,000 budget, $8,000 of which was spent on a wig they had to buy because they had to do some reshoots and the actor cut her hair.
